Two People Injured In Crash At Indiana Limestone Acquisition

(FAYETTEVILLE) – Two people were injured in an accident while driving through Indiana Limestone Acquisition on Wednesday afternoon.

According to a Lawrence County Sheriff’s Department report, officers were alerted to the crash at 3:40 p.m.

30-year-old Williams Miller, of Mitchell, was driving through the company lot in the 7050 block of State Road 158 when he dropped a beverage bottle onto the floorboard. Miller attempted to retrieve the bottle but it ended up pinning the accelerator pedal of a 2003 Ford F-350 owned by the company to the floor.

The vehicle collided with a pile of stacked limestone rocks and caused extensive damage to the vehicle.

The truck airbag deployed during the incident.

Miller suffered minor injuries but refused medical treatment. His passenger, 27-year-old John Thomas, of Solsberry, suffered a shoulder injury and was transported by an IU Health Hospital ambulance to IU Health Hospital for treatment.
